Concern: Are your techniques risk-free for family animals? Question: We were informed by the initial individual who came to see what service we need that we would certainly need to be out of your house a minimum of four hours, that our felines had to be out as well, which our fish most likely wouldn't make it.


Response: You do NOT have to run out your home, the pets need only be avoided cured surfaces till they (the surface areas) are completely dry . and cover the fish tanks/bowls (bed bug services). Chemicals for family insects are created to be used at low focus, normally less than 1 percent. These concentrations are high sufficient to be efficient in killing small bugs, but position no risk to people or pet dogs


Dealt with surface areas usually dry rapidly, so there is long shot for direct exposure from them. The residue that stays on the surface will be poisonous to pests, however provides no hazard to individuals. It generally does not last really long, however long enough for the target bugs to contact it and die.

The level of sensitivity of both pet dogs and children to chemicals made use of in parasite control can not be overemphasized. Kids, due to their establishing bodies and behaviors such as hand-to-mouth activity, can be specifically prone to unsafe materials. Many pets, particularly those that regularly communicate with the dealt with atmospheres, might display adverse reactions to chemical exposure.

Chemical insecticides can present health dangers if consumed or inhaled. It is advised to take required precautions during the treatment procedure. This could include ensuring that pet dogs and youngsters are stayed out of dealt with locations for details durations, generally described in the supplier's directions. After therapies, extensive cleansing and ventilation of the room can aid alleviate any kind of lingering chemical residues, making it more secure for re-entry by animals and kids.




When handling a bed pest infestation, it's essential to comprehend not just the efficiency of the chemical treatments employed yet also the safety of other citizens in the home, particularly pets. Making use of chemicals can position risks, and therefore, implementing stringent safety standards is crucial. Prior to commencing any type of chemical therapy, it's recommended to eliminate petssuch as felines and dogsfrom the premises.

Several pesticide tags have specific directions concerning the secure re-entry times for family pets and human beings, which ought to constantly be adhered to. During therapy, animals need to be relocated to a risk-free setting away from the chemicals, ideally a buddy or family participant's home. In cases where that isn't feasible, a shut area far from the therapy website with sufficient air flow and no Our site exposure to the chemicals must be developed.

Moms and dads and caregivers must take proactive actions to protect children from exposure to pesticides and various other chemicals used in bug control. To ensure safety and security, it is advisable to remove children from the treated area during and after the application of chemical therapies. Normally, specialists advise abandoning the home for a minimum of 2-4 hours, and in many cases, it might be essential to steer clear of for a full day, relying on the specific substances made use of.

Furthermore, after the treatment has actually been completed and the location aired out, it is smart to carry out a detailed cleansing of all surface areas, including vacuuming carpets, drapes, and paddings. This can help remove any kind of residue that might have settled post-treatment. Moms and dads ought to also that site check their youngsters's wellness complying with obliteration initiatives for any kind of uncommon signs and symptoms, especially in the days promptly following therapy.

Signs and symptoms of toxicity in youngsters can include throwing up, dizziness, and lethargy, and in extreme cases, it might lead to significant neurological impacts. Animals are equally in danger, and some chemicals that are risk-free for people can be harmful to pets. Felines and pets may experience stomach issues, neurological signs and symptoms, and skin rashes after exposure to chemicals.

Another option consists of vacuuming. Routine vacuuming can considerably lower bed pest populations by removing not just the bugs but likewise their eggs and dropped skins. It is important to utilize a vacuum with a HEPA filter to avoid the insects from escaping back right into the setting. After vacuuming, the bag should be thrown away immediately to avoid any type of chance of re-infestation.
